Al Nasr s initiative to safeguard freedom of opinion and speech

Al Nasr Coalition submits to the House of Representatives a proposed law to cancel the text of Articles 225 and 226 of the Penal Act No. 111 of 1969, in order to cancel the texts that contradict the freedom of opinion and expression stipulated in the constitution of the Republic of Iraq.

 

Article 1

The text of Articles 225 and 226 of the Penal Act No. 111 of 1969 must be repealed.

Article 2

This law will be effective once it is published in the formal newspaper.

 

The necessary reasons:

In order to repeal texts that conflict with freedom of opinion and speech stipulated in the Constitution of the Republic of Iraq of 2005, this law was enacted.

 

Below is the text of Articles 225 and 226 of the Penal Act No. 111 of 1969:

Article 225

Whoever insults the President of the Republic, or who takes his place, by any method of publicity, Shall be punished by imprisonment for a period not exceeding seven years or by jail.

Article 226

Whoever insults the National Assembly, the government, the courts, the armed forces, or other statutory bodies, public authorities, departments, or official or semi-official departments, shall be punished with imprisonment for a period not exceeding seven years, or with jail or a fine.
